    Set in a 10 acre working farm, each room has a small verandah area which looks out over garden, paddocks and bush. Guests are free to wander the grounds. Rooms are very comfortable and tastefully appointed, with a small fridge, tea and coffee and even complimentary port. Breakfast at 7.30am was generous, including cereal, toast, fruit salad and cooked English. Hosts friendly and unobtrusive.
